Featured dishes

View full menu
Cup Of Coffee - $2
Ground to order from locally roasted fairtrade beans, brewed by the best machine in West Wales - Carat V1, crafted and presented to you either to table in porcelain, or as a take-away. You choose how you'd like your tea, and just tell us.
Cup Of Coffee - $2
Freshly brewed to order in japanese heavy bottomed castiron pots. Choose from over 20 mixes of teas blended in Mid Wales. Many options available, between black, green and fruit infusions.
Kanapki
We have been serving "kanapki" sandwiches from the very beginning, and they have always been the bestsellers. Choice is different everyday, due to availability of produce and fantasy of chefess. Check blackboards for current menu, or tell us what combination you'd fancy. We bake our own bread for kanapki every morning, and they are available till it runs out. The all-time favourite is the acclaimed "grilled halloumi with avocado", but recently Reuben is fighting for top choice title.

One of the two highest-rated cafes/eateries in Carmarthen and absolutely deserves that accolade. Attached is Saturday 23rd's brunch menu for reference only.

We (2 of us) received a warm welcome, inadvertently chose Kidwelly Castle table (where sister lives, all tables have their own castle name, cute touch) and the welcome was warm and efficient, distributing menus, offering drinks and pointing out the Specials.

Dining partner had the Miso Mushrooms special, I had scrambled eggs, with a side of bacon and hash brown. What arrived was far beyond expectations, portions huge, utterly delicious. I normally don't bang on in too much detail but everything was utterly fresh, local, well-seasoned, constructed and creative (e.g. the mushrooms had slivers of brussel sprouts tossed through along with fresh herbs) and hot.

Most important to mention - they were the best hash browns I have ever tasted (and I'm a food snob who lives in Australia where food is seriously good).

The venue appears small but there's also a downstairs section expanding potential seating and the toilet was immaculate with individual hands towels ...

The whole place was a delight, which very much includes those who worked there. Why only 4 stars for Atmosphere? Other than 1 additional couple also eating brunch who left relatively shortly after we arrived, we were the only people there.

For anyone reading this ... Please make the effort and support this eaterie. It's worth every penny and needs to be in Carmarthen town centre for a long time to come .... Cheers.

PS, I'm not related to anyone who owns this joint or works...

Absolutely amazing cafe! Incredible food, made fresh every day. And it's clearly a huge hit with the locals, when I was in there, lots of people stopping in to say hi, have a chat, get a bit of coffee and maybe a cheeky slice of cake or something. It's easy to see why, as well, because it's such a nice and friendly vibe in there.

But for me, this isn't enough for 5 stars. What seals the deal for me is the food. Absolutely amazing. Without a doubt, probably the best food I've had since I've been in the UK. It's all made fresh and I even saw it being made.

My only regret was that I wasn't in Camarthen for the special gourmet dinner nights they have, I believe it's twice a month. I understand that the spaces are limited, and you should probably book in advance, but I saw the next menu and it sounded extremely exciting. I hope to come back to Carmarthen with my girlfriend some day soon, and I'll try and time it to coincide with the gourmet night, what a perfect date it will be.

So, all in all, absolutely fantastic cafe, very friendly and warm atmosphere and the most...

Met a friend for lunch today at Y Barbican. It was very busy. We had a 15 minute wait for a table, so we sat outside while we had a drink. The only available table was downstairs, which is quite dark, so we requested to eat outside instead. Despite being very busy, the waitress was thoroughly understanding and amenable and thankfully, the rain held off! I had courgette and mozzarella fritters with a selection of salads, fermented cabbage, grated carrot, tabbouleh, beetroot hummus which was a feast for the eyes! The fritters were absolutely delicious and the rest of the plate fresh and full of flavour. I left enough room for almond tart with cream, which was perfect….lovely light pastry. My friend had smoked salmon with poached eggs from the brunch menu which was also delicious. All in all, a thoroughly enjoyable experience at a reasonable price. The staff are friendly, informative and professional. Given the space available, the food produced here is magic! Well done,...

Y Barbican is one of my favourite places to lunch. The food is absolutely delicious, I've tried 3 different lunch items now and each one has been incredible. The portions are large, the food is freshly cooked (you are seated close to the chefs so you can see how hard they are working). The staff greeting you are always friendly and attentive when taking orders. The dining area is small and seating is limited, but it is well worth waiting if it is full. I can't recommend Y Barbican enough! My only criticism (if it can be called a criticism) is there aren't many options for vegans on the menu, so there are certain friends I probably wouldn't bring here yet, however with the menu constantly changing I'm sure this will change over time.

Unbelievable food. You can really tell that the staff care about the quality of the food they serve. If you live in the area or are visiting, this is a must-try. Good energy in the kitchen and you can tell by the flavours! I’ve worked in food & wine industry for a good while and I was blown away by the food presentation, quality of ingredients, and the service. It was hard to choose what to order; luckily my table was keen to share lots of small plates. I would highly recommend sharing a few things. I will absolutely return to try more of the breakfast & daytime menu. Great wine options also. I was told that they update the menu regularly with seasonal ingredients so I’m very excited to keep visiting!
